Choose the Best Breed

-

Michelle Schubert researched multiple sheep breeds before choosing Southdown Babydoll sheep for her Bergamasco­s’ Babydoll Brigade farm in Stomping Ground, Kentucky. In addition to their diminutive size and overall adorablene­ss, Schubert appreciate­d their versatilit­y.

“They sell well in the companion, pet and 4-H/FFA markets; they are used in vineyards, sustainabl­e agricultur­e and organic farming; and their wool is favored among spinners and fiber artists,” she says. “They also have select carcass value for the table … and some folks even milk them.”

Think about your goals for raising livestock — meat, milk, fiber, show, companions — and choose the breed that will best meet those needs.
